Design and Portability

In terms of design, the Lasko MyHeat Personal Space Heater is notably compact, standing just 6 inches tall with a footprint of 4” x 4”, making it ideal for small spaces. This compactness allows it to fit seamlessly under desks or on desks without taking up much room. The Ceramic Space Heater, while portable as well, is larger and designed for broader heating needs, suitable for various rooms in a home or office. Users looking for a truly portable option may find the Lasko model more convenient for personal use.

Heating Efficiency

The Ceramic Space Heater offers three power settings of 700W, 1000W, and 1500W, allowing users to adjust the heat output based on their environment. This flexibility is beneficial for larger areas or varying temperature conditions. In contrast, the Lasko MyHeat operates at a lower power of 200W, making it less suitable for heating larger spaces but ideal for focused warmth in personal areas. For those seeking significant heating capabilities, the Ceramic Space Heater provides a more robust solution.

Safety Features

Safety is a crucial consideration in heater design, and both models incorporate essential safety features. The Ceramic Space Heater boasts multiple safety protections, including tip-over shutoff and overheat protection, ensuring safe usage especially for families with children or pets. The Lasko MyHeat, while simpler in its design, includes automatic overheat protection and a self-regulating ceramic heating element that keeps the exterior cool to the touch. Both products are ETL listed, highlighting their commitment to safety standards.

User-Friendliness

When it comes to user-friendliness, the Ceramic Space Heater excels with its smart thermostat and timer function, allowing users to set heating times between 1 to 12 hours. The included remote control enhances convenience, although it requires separate batteries. The Lasko MyHeat, on the other hand, is designed for immediate use with no assembly required—just plug it into a standard outlet. Its straightforward controls make it easy to operate, particularly for those who may not be technologically inclined.
